Output e17888899f0271c86b8634da1a5d29c961f137ee28373cc082025cec75139771:4

value
163359043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2780ada6975cf1d4382e70382686756be44e70e OP_EQUAL
address
MUYckUYX9LFdRW2ViA4hLE86JECYMPU2m5
transaction
e17888899f0271c86b8634da1a5d29c961f137ee28373cc082025cec75139771
spent
true